Front
Climate
Back
The general weather of a particular area over a long period of time.
2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Continental Drift Theory
Back
The theory that states Earth's continents were once joined together as one supercontinent, called Pangaea, and have since drifted apart to their present-day locations.
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Convection Currents
Back
The circular flows of material, generally liquids or gases, caused by temperature differences.
4.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Fossil Evidence
Back
The preserved remains of extinct organisms that provide geological records of past events.
5.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Mid-Ocean Ridge
Back
An underwater mountain belt formed by seafloor spreading where rising magma creates new crust.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Pangaea
Back
The huge landmass or supercontinent Earth's seven continents once formed about 250 million years ago.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Plate Tectonic Theory
Back
The theory that states Earth's surface is broken into large slabs of rock, whose movements cause the formation of various landforms as well as phenomena such as volcanic eruptions and earthquakes; also known as plate tectonics.
